This is a direct contination of the story begun in the first book, The Golden Age. Our hero is now an outcast, as those in charge do not want him around, and work out how to get rid of him. He now must make his way among an outcast society, with no resources or assistance. I read the first in this series, The Golden Age some time ago and quite enjoyed it. This second volume is also enjoyable - still the same dense writing, but our hero turns out to be pretty fallible on a human level and appears to learn and change as the book goes on, and Wright appears to be questioning the underside of his affluent networked society. Indeed at one point I almost hoped the book was going to turn into a series of vignettes of different groups functioning on the margins, but it turned out a bit different. Anyway, it was fun. (
